Advanced Snail 96 Mucin Power Essence from K-Beauty Brand COSRX makes for a memorable present, thanks to its main ingredient (snail mucin!) and its potential benefits for the skin. Snail mucin contains a number of skin-healthy ingredients like hyaluronic acid — a powerful antioxidant that one past study noted can help bond water to tissue, leaving your skin soft and supple.

Another small study, published in July 2015 in the Korean Journal of Dermatology, suggested that a cream containing 80 percent snail mucin effectively improved skin elasticity, tightened skin, and reduced the appearance of wrinkles after four weeks. (The COSRX product contains 96 percent snail mucin, hence the name.)This product is 100 percent cruelty-free, and no snails are harmed in the making of the product, reports Cruelty Free Only blog. However, as it’s an animal-derived product, it’s not suitable for vegans.

Looking for a beauty tool that’ll fit perfectly in your stocking? Opt for a rose quartz face roller, says Kathleen Cook Suozzi, MD, the director of the aesthetic dermatology program at Yale Medicine and an assistant professor at the Yale University School of Medicine in New Haven, Connecticut. While there’s a lack of scientific research behind these tools, they can really help to de-puff your skin, she says: “If you wake up a little tired or bloated after your holiday party, or you drank too much champagne, you can chill your face roller in the fridge, and then you can roll the puffiness out, helping the lymphatic system remove excess fluids and toxins that collect under the skin.”
